Unified Communications Platform
Overview
Microsoft’s
Unified Communication Platform integrates the new and traditional communication
and collaboration channels using various software products. Traditional
communication channels like phones, fax etc and newer computing based channels
like emails, A/V conferencing, Instant Messaging, VoIP telephone service etc.
The objective of
this platform is to improve Communication and Collaboration
between teams and individuals.
The services
which UC platform provides are:
·
VoIP telephone service
·
E-mail
·
Audio and video conferencing
·
Voice mail
·
Presence and contact information
·
Faxes
·
Instant messaging
·
Calendaring
·
Speech technology-enabled Interactive Voice Response
UC platform
provides three kinds of services and products:
·
Server products hosted in-premise
·
Hosted by Microsoft
·
Hosted by Partners
The set of
products which constitutes UC platform are:
·
Microsoft Office Communications Server 2007
o
Manages real-time synchronous communication which includes instant
messaging, VoIP, audio and video conferencing.
·
Microsoft Office Communicator 2007 (client)
o
Client for real-time communication which works with Microsoft
Office Communications Server 2007.
·
Microsoft Exchange Server 2007
o
Manages all asynchronous communication which includes email, voice
mail, faxes and calendars. Microsoft Office Outlook 2007 is the client for
Exchange Server 2007.
·
Microsoft Office Communications Server 2007 Speech Server
o
IVR platform with built-in support for speech recognition and
speech synthesis.
o
Supports .NET programming languages and voice Web standards like
VoiceXML and SALT.
